COUNCIL TO CO-OPT TO FILL VACANCY

A notice of vacancy was advertised by Stone Parish Council from 9th-26th August 2011, following the sad death of council member Thurza Richards.

Electors from Stone Village Ward were entitled to send a request to the Returning Officer at Dartford Borough Council asking for an election to fill the vacancy.

No requests for an election were recived by the deadline, leaving the Parish Council open to co-opt to fill the vacancy at the next appropriate opportunity.

Subject to approval at September's meeting, the council will invite expressions of interest from prospective candidates to explain why they would like to be considered as a councillor and describing what experience/skills they might bring to the council.

A vote is scheduled to take place at the full council meeting in October to conclude the appointment.

Deadline for receipt of Expressions of Interest is Wednesday 5th October 2011.

Any person co-opted to the council must meet the usual qualifications to be a councillor.

Exciting Opportunity 

The role of a councillor is very varied and involves contributing to decisions on local policies and issues affecting residents. Council meetings are held once a month and, on average, being a councillor requires around 10 hour’s commitment per month.

This is a fantastic opportunity for someone to get involved in real grass roots democracy and influence local services and facilities for the benefit of the community. The Council is also involved with some very exciting projects including recent construction of a new pavilion and events such as Stone Fete.

Candidates wishing to be considered must be a British or Commonwealth citizen, over 21 and on the Electoral Roll. In addition he/she must either have lived or worked in or within three miles of the parish.
